Trading activities of 4 Stock Brokers prohibited

April, 24, 2018

Colombo Stock Exchange (CSE) in a notice to clients of Stock Broker firms said that it had prohibited carrying out trading activities of 4 firms due to non-compliance with rule 5.1.1. and 5.2.1 of the CSE Stock Broker rules.

Accordingly renown Investment Banker and former CSE Director (2013) Asanga Seneviratne owned Nation Lanka Equities, former Ceylinco Money Broker turned investor - Harsha De Silva owned Navara Securities, Malaysian Investor and Politician - Tiong King Sing owned TKS Securities and Mackwoods Group owned Claridge Stock Brokers had been prohibited from trading activities effective 17th April 2018 due to Non Compliance with minimum shareholders' funds requirement. Further it was noted that Nation Lanka Equities and Navara Securities had been Non Compliance with Minimum Capital Adequacy Requirements effective from 9th October 2017 and 22nd March 2018 respectively.

CSE said that the prohibited broker firms will be permitted to resume all trading activities no sooner the said firms comply with the Minimum Capital Adequacy Requirements and Minimum Shareholders' Funds Requirement as applicable. Meanwhile clients were informed by the notice to transfer their securities portfolios to any other stock broker firm custodian bank of their choice are kindly requested to contact the respective stock broker firms.
